Output 13fd0154c369d99fc9f51354cf05af1de912efdd1b23994bc6f2ee46042a149b:18

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59d755ba13b160cf92811adfefa5d44355a86e6b OP_EQUAL
address
39t42M1QRN8s85M27E8pNRsspPATkZHEJZ
transaction
13fd0154c369d99fc9f51354cf05af1de912efdd1b23994bc6f2ee46042a149b
spent
true